Name announced for 680-home Littleport development
28 Sep 2021

A flagship development which is set to create a new 680-home community in Littleport has been named Quantum Fields. The project, which has been earmarked for a 70-acre site off Grange Lane, is a joint venture by Vistry Group and Evera Homes. The name of the development takes its inspiration from Quantum Field Theory, a 20th Century theory relating to how different particles interact to make up the building blocks of matter. Vistry Group, which comprises Bovis Homes, Linden Homes and Vistry Partnerships, and Evera Homes, formed of the housing associations Cross Keys Homes, Longhurst, Hyde and Flagship Group, chose the name to reflect the unity and sense of community they hope to create within the new development. As well as up to 680 new homes, Quantum Fields will also provide a community hall, public open space, community orchard and retail units. Emma Fletcher, managing director of Evera Homes, said: “Quantum Fields are the building blocks for everything in life, and the theory refers to the bringing together of two scientific concepts that merge to become a whole new entity. This perfectly describes our joint venture with Vistry and is why we are so excited to be bringing forward Quantum Fields together. “At Evera, we have a strong desire to see a sense of community built into developments from the start, with a keen eye on sustainability and ensuring low running costs for customers. Together with access to green spaces and policy compliant affordable housing levels, we want to change the way large scale developments are delivered. “Vistry brings a wealth of knowledge and experience in the development sector to the scheme, and together we have a host of skills and knowledge to deliver excellent-quality homes in one of East Cambridgeshire’s most popular villages.” Outline planning permission has already been granted for the development. If detailed plans are approved, Quantum Fields will comprise a variety of two, three and four-bedroom houses built under the Bovis Homes and Linden Homes brands.
